Name: Bleach
Type: Manga
Author: Tite Kubo
Books: 74
Genre: Action, adventure, supernatural
Age Rating: 14+


Review:

A boy named Ichigo gains supernatural abilities when Rukia, the Soul-Reaper, accidentally gives him all of her powers. He--along with a team of fellow spiritually-sensitive friends--save the world and other people from evil.

Action-packed and kind of violent, this series is similar to Yuyu Hakashu, though with more characters, and, in my opinion, a better plot. The characters were honorable and though it was mostly action, it didn't take away from the story. There wasn't any romance or overly-fluffy scenes, but the fighting scenes were really good, which I why I believe this series may attract boys more than girls. However, I enjoyed reading all 686 chapters. It was especially fun to read them along with my younger brother, who started reading them before I did.  


This series can get a little redundant, but this series, you must remember, is a fighting manga. It does have a story-line, and an abundance of characters, many of whom are hilarious and fun to follow. Older boys will definitely enjoy the action-packed hero story and watching Ichigo get stronger and stronger in order to defeat his enemies (who also keep getting stronger).

Mature Content: 

  • Violence- The characters have a lot of battles with enemies
    • Some blood and gore (loss of limbs and unnatural pain tolerances)
  • Sexual References- Unnaturally-sized breasts and some skimpy outfits
    • Orihime's boobs are talked about a lot
  • Spiritual- Characters posses supernatural abilities
    • Soul Reapers have spiritual "auras"
    • The Soul Society is the world's "afterlife"
